Netzer Precision
Founded in 1998, Netzer Precision is a designer and manufacturer of ultra‑high‑precision absolute capacitive rotary encoders. The company relies on its proprietary Electric Encoder™ technology, a contactless capacitive technology that delivers performance equivalent to optical encoders without their fragility, and surpasses magnetic encoders in environments with high electromagnetic interference (EMI), high temperatures, or where very long operational life is required.
The company offers both standard catalog products and custom developments to meet the most demanding specifications. The unique contactless (hollow shaft) design ensures very high compactness, low inertia, as well as exceptional robustness and longevity, particularly for industrial, robotic, medical, aerospace and defense applications.
Electric Encoder™ Technology
The Electric Encoder™ technology is based on an innovative capacitive principle, protected by a patent filed as early as 2002. Unlike optical encoders, it uses no fragile components; unlike magnetic encoders, it is completely insensitive to magnetic fields and electromagnetic interference (EMI/RFI).
The sensor core relies on a contactless design with a hollow shaft. This architecture eliminates any wearing parts (bearings, contact), ensuring long‑term reliability in critical applications. Key advantages include:
-
Zero (undetectable) magnetic signature
-
Immunity to EMI/RFI and magnetic fields
-
Lightweight construction and low inertia
-
Very thin profile (≤10 mm)
-
Angular accuracy up to ±0.001° (depending on series)
Product Ranges
1. VLX Series (Robotics & Industry) – Hollow Shaft
Designed for industrial automation and robotics. Ultra‑flat format. Diameter from 25 to 247 mm.
2. VLP Series (Harsh Environment) – Hollow Shaft
Ultra‑light, very thin, for extreme environments. Diameter from 13 to 247 mm.
3. VLS Series (Space – LEO) – Hollow Shaft
The only flight‑proven COTS space encoder, for satellites and launchers. Diameter from 25 to 247 mm.
4. VLT Series (Extreme Temperature) – Hollow Shaft
Extended temperature range (-55°C to +125°C) for aerospace and defense applications.
5. VLZ Series (Capacitive Angle Encoder) – Hollow Shaft
Unmatched accuracy of 0.001°, maximum resistance to magnetic fields and EMI.
6. DS Series (Encapsulated) – Hollow Shaft
Proven encapsulated solutions, up to 23 bits (0.006°). Diameter from 16 to 130 mm.
7. VLM Series (Multi‑Turn) – Hollow Shaft
Multi‑turn function for applications requiring measurement over several revolutions.
8. DL Series (Spindle / Shaft Encoder)
Solid‑shaft format for conventional shaft mounting.
